My Story

Our little Down is a special case....she came into the shelter as a little sick feral kitten. She was very scared and all alone. It took some time to get her over her intestinal parasites and she had to be isolated during treatment. At the shelter Dove was very shut down and stayed crouched down attempting to hide all the time. She would allow herself to be picked up and she would just curl into you as you petted and held her. She recently spent time at a foster home with three other cats and we have seen such a change in her. She purrs like crazy when you pet and scratch her along the back, she has begun playing with toys and coming out to get fed. Dove would really blossom in a quiet home with a patient owner who could give her the loves she so needs. In foster care she was walking about and getting in the foster's lap to be petted. She loves to play with feathers on a wand, or pipe cleaner spider toys. She quietly watches the other cats and even interacts with them. Watching a former feral kitty become a happy member of a family can be super rewarding. Dove would be great with another cat or two and a person who loves shy girls. She would not do well in a busy household with children as she is still very shy but oh, the progress she has made in only ten days in a foster home.
